Fako Division: 8 killed in Tiko fuel tanker explosion
Eight people were killed and several others injured after a fuel tanker exploded early Friday in Cameroon’s Southwest Region, authorities said. The tanker, which had departed the seaside resort town of Limbe and was en route to the commercial hub of Douala, overturned and burst into flames before exploding on a highway in the town […]

Cameroon-Ukraine tensions: Kiev sanctions 3 Cameroon-flagged ships for Russian wheat transport
Three vessels sailing under the flag of Cameroon are among the 56 ships recently sanctioned by Ukraine. On November 25, acting on a proposal from the National Security and Defense Council,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ky signed a decree targeting vessels that export goods, mainly Russian wheat, from the ports of Sevastopol and Feodosia in Crimea, […]

Cameroon signals urgency on biometric voter ID collection as presidential vote nears
Calls are multiplying from officials of Cameroon’s elections management agency (ELECAM) across the country for registered voters to take possession of their biometric voter cards in a move that has been considered a race against time. The election agency is now racing to distribute both backlogged old cards and newly printed ones as the country’s […]
